Samantha Shatz is a Toronto, Ontario lawyer at Howie, Sacks & Henry LLP, where her practice is focused on medical malpractice and medical negligence claims. She represents individuals and families affected by medical and hospital negligence, approaching each matter with care, preparation, and close attention to detail.

As a Partner at Howie, Sacks & Henry LLP, Samantha draws on experience gained from both plaintiff personal injury litigation and insurance defence work. This background provides valuable insight into how medical negligence claims are assessed and defended, allowing her to guide clients through each stage of the legal process with clarity and transparency.

Samantha has been recognized by Best Lawyers since 2025, reflecting consistent professional dedication and peer acknowledgement within the legal community. Her practice involves managing complex medical negligence files and advocating for clients throughout negotiation and litigation.

She has acted as trial counsel before the Ontario Superior Court of Justice, representing both individuals and insurers. In addition to medical malpractice and medical negligence matters, Samantha also handles motor vehicle accident and occupiers’ liability claims.

At Howie, Sacks & Henry LLP, Samantha works closely with a collaborative legal team to address legal and factual issues thoroughly. She is committed to providing practical guidance while upholding the firm’s longstanding focus on integrity and client-centered representation.

Samantha serves on the American Association for Justice Board of Governors and has previously served on the Board of Directors for the Brain Injury Society of Toronto. She is also a member of the Brain Injury Awareness Committee and is actively involved in supporting individuals and families living with brain injuries.
